Peer Learning Assistant Professional Development

CETL provides professional development to Peer Learning Assistants (PLAs). Through an asynchronous, Moodle-based platform, PLAs receive development with the following learning objectives:

  • Maintain regular communication with and seek feedback from the course instructor
  • Integrate active-learning techniques into peer-to-peer instruction and support peers in developing their own active learning practices
  • Facilitate learning using online resources including Moodle, Zoom, and Panopto
  • Implement practices to foster an inclusive and anti-racist learning environment
  • Reflect upon teaching and learning and the choices they make in their PLA role
  • Make active use of campus resources, including the library, ITS, Career Connections Center, and accessibility services to enhance student learning
